Make up the equations for the reactions of combustion of the following substances in oxygen: a) magnesium b) calcium c) silicon d) hydrogen e) silane (SiH4) .Set the coefficients.

a) Magnesium is a divalent metal, therefore there are no indices when combined with oxygen.
2Mg + O2 = 2MgO
b) Calcium is a divalent metal, therefore, when combined with oxygen, there are no indices.
2Ca + O2 = 2CaO
c) Silicon in combination with oxygen has a valency IV, since oxygen is divalent, it will have an index of 2.
Si + O2 = SiO2
d) Hydrogen has a constant valence I, since oxygen is divalent, then hydrogen will have an index of 2.
2H2 + O2 = 2H20
e) Silane, when combined with oxygen, decomposes into silicon oxide (IV) and water.
